What is the RN on clothing?

If you see an RN number on a clothing label, it provides a quick way to identify the manufacturer or company behind the product. This unique identifier helps consumers verify the authenticity of garments and access more information about the brand. Can you date clothing by RN number?

Start by locating the RN number tag on the clothing label. This unique identifier helps trace the manufacturer and gather detailed information about the garment. Familiarize yourself with how RN numbers are printed–often as a small, distinct code that can be easily overlooked. Next, visit the official Federal Trade Commission (FTC) RN lookup database.
